You Could Be Buying Adulterated Ranbaxy Drugs

You Could Be Buying Adulterated Ranbaxy Drugs The "jiyo jee bhar ke" drug maker Ranbaxy Laboratories Ltd, agreed to pay $500 million [in civil and criminal fines under the settlement agreement with the US Department of Justice (DOJ)], approximately Rs 2,743 crore, to resolve the fraud allegations made in account their selling adulterated drugs. King of Romance Yash Chopra Passes Away

Veteran filmmaker Yash Chopra, hailed as 'King of Romance', died here at the Lilavati Hospital Sunday, following multiple organ failure. The 80-year-old was suffering from dengue. Continue Reading »
